Function config_id_frame_v1_hw() is called twice for
each PHY during initialisation, which is unneeded.

So remove init_id_frame_v1_hw(), which only calls
config_id_frame_v1_hw().

We will keep the call to config_id_frame_v1_hw()
in start_phy_v1_hw() since it will be used for
PHY reset functions.
